Transformer fault diagnosis and repair is a complex task that includes many possible types of faults and demands special trained personnel. In this paper, Petri Nets are used for the simulation of transformer fault diagnosis process and the definition of the actions followed to repair the transformer. A new approach for protection of power transformer is presented using a time-frequency transform known as Wavelet transform. Different operating conditions such as inrush, Normal, load, External fault and internal fault current are sampled and processed to obtain wavelet coefficients. This paper presents the use of ANN as a pattern classifier for differential protection of power transformer, which makes the discrimination among normal, magnetizing inrush, over-excitation, external fault and internal fault currents.
